Wheat Pita Bread For 'Ramzan' Season
During this occasion , the food that the Muslims eat is light, nutritious meals that contain a lot of fresh fruits , vegetables and halal meats. Many types of food can be prepared and with so many Muslims all over the world celebrating this holy festival there are different varieties.
The Whole Wheat Pita Bread is one such food that is famous in all Muslim houses during this special holy season. It is indeed perfect for those of you who are looking to add more more wheat ingredients to your diet. This bread has both white and wheat flour and is really simple to make.
To
get
started
you
need
:-
Warm
Water-
21/2
cups
Dry
Yeast-
11/2
spoon
Honey-
I
tsp
Wheat
Flour-
2
cups
Purpose
Flour-3
cups
vegetable
Oil-
1
tsp
Salt
to
taste
Directions:-
- You have to first dissolve the yeast in warm water . Add honey to it and stir. Afetr about 10 to 15 minutes the water will begin to froth.
- Now in a separate bowl, you have to mix the wheat flour and the white flour along with the salt for taste.
- After you mix the flour continuously, make a small depression in the middle and pour the yeast water.
- Now add in some warm yeast water and stir with a wooden spoon preferably until you see the dough becoming elastic.
- Knead the dough till it becomes smooth and elastic.
- In a large bowl of vegetable oil , place the dough so that it is covered in the oil. Cover it and let it stay for about 3 hours. Let it be in a warm place until it has doubled in size.
- Once you see that the dough is doubled , roll out in a rope and pinch out 10 to 12 pieces . Now roll out the dough into circles with a rolling pin, onto a floured surface.
- Make sure that each piece is about 5 to 6 inches across and ¼ inches thick.
- In a n oven of 500 degree C, bake the circled shaped dough for 4 minutes till it puffs up. Like wise turn over the dough and bake again for 2 minutes.
- After it baked, remove the pita with a wooden spatula and gently push down the puff and ploace in the storage bag.
To keep the Pita Bread for a longer time, you have to store it well in a proper place so that you can keep it longer and it will stay fresh every time you grab a bite. It can be stored for a month too if you keep it in a freezer bag and place it in the refrigerator.
